Description of problem

ok i bought a domain from godaddy and i want to use it as the main domain to replace the .forumotion.com how do i do that

Hello,

You should be able to add it to your forum in ACP-->General-->Forum Address-->Personalized domain name you should be able to add it there.


Note: You must be logged in as the founder to do this.
